ADJ: A district office adjudication case. ADJ PJ: The presiding judge (PJ) in the district office. Adjourn (hearing): When a hearing is ended by the hearing official and another hearing must be scheduled before the case can be resolved. Appeal: A request made by a case participant to change a case decision.
Where can I find my ADJ number? You can look up your ADJ number by using the EAMS Search Function or you can contact the Information and Assistance office nearest to you. The ADJ number can also be found on most documents filed with DWC.

(c) Licensed members of the California State Bar, acting as an attorney of record for a party, are required to issue their own subpoenas and subpoenas duces tecum. When issuing subpoenas, the attorney shall comply with the provisions of Sections 1985 to 1985.6, inclusive, of the Code of Civil Procedure.

Any subpoena seeking records from the Division must be personally served on the Chief Counsel of the Division, or his/or her designee, at the Division's Legal Office. Please be advised that the Division will not accept service of a subpoena by mail, email or facsimile.

In California, worker's compensation records?including settlements?are public record, but there are laws protecting information located in a case file from being made open to the public for just any reason.
Most offices have information and assistance (I&A) officers on staff, who provide a variety of services to injured workers, employers and others.
